The Real Chicago — an eye-catching, family friendly entertainment magazine for active locals and tourists — originally launched in 2006. It now has a sister publication: The Real Park Ridge. Proud to be servicing our new home in Park Ridge, as well as the surrounding areas of Rosemont, Niles, Des Plaines, Mt. Prospect and NW Chicago.

The Real Park Ridge is printed and distributed seasonally four times per year (December, March, June and September) to thousands of Park Ridge homes, as well as more than 150 area restaurants, bars, boutiques, coffee shops, salons, spas, offices and hotels. The Chef’s Cut steak boards at the new @fireandw The Chef’s Cut steak boards at the new @fireandwinege on Touhy in Park Ridge are something to behold. Available Friday and Saturday nights, they're focused on exceptional cuts, bold flavors and refined pairings.

A sample steak board includes a choice between:
*Flavorful, hand-cut 14-ounce prime NY strip
*A 12-ounce Linz Heritage Angus Reserve bone-in filet
*A well marbled, hand-cut 14-ounce prime ribeye
*A filet trio featuring gorgonzola, horseradish and crab

Don’t forget the curated wine pairings, and you can take your steak night to the next level with one of their housemade sauces and shareable sides.

When we asked one of our Park Ridge Insiders, Jess When we asked one of our Park Ridge Insiders, Jesse Brady, for the best meal she's had recently, she couldn't name just one. Or three. And that's OK. 

"I could never pick just one! How about a few? The carbonara in a jar at @ziassocial — creamy, decadent, delicious. And the perfect meal to celebrate pre-school graduation. The chicken caprese at @fireandwinege — an unexpected trip to flavortown for date night. The acai bowl at @bonitabowl — a great option for something light and fresh on the go after a workout. The grilled calamari salad at @nonnasilvias — my first time having grilled calamari, and I’ll definitely have it again. The Rosso Diavolo pizza at @fornorosso on Harlem — perfect for sharing during a girls’ night when you want to try a piece but not have the whole pizza. And of course, the creme brûlée dessert is a staple order from @thecapitalgrille for special occasions."
